Quick & Easy Garlicky Vermicelli (Rice Noodles)

A quick and comforting garlic vermicelli dish that’s fragrant, savoury, and ready in minutes. Perfect as a side or a light main when you want something fast and flavourful.
Course Lunch, dinner
Cuisine Asian, Chinese, Taiwanese
Servings 2 people

Ingredients
  

  • 2 packs dried rice noodles about 95g total
  • Vegetable oil for cooking
  • 2 tbsp finely chopped garlic
  • 1 tbsp finely chopped spring onion
  • 1 tsp finely chopped chilli optional; remove seeds for less heat
  • A large handful of coriander to garnish or spring onion if preferred

FOR THE SAUCE *adjust to taste

  • 1 & 1/4 tbsp soy sauce
  • 1 tbsp oyster sauce or mushroom oyster sauce for a vegetarian option
  • 1 tsp sugar
  • A pinch of white pepper
  • ½ tsp sesame oil
  • 90 ml water

Instructions
 

  • Soak the noodles : Soak the rice noodles in warm water for 5–7 minutes, until just softened (about 70–80% soft). Drain well and set aside.
  • Prepare the sauce : In a small bowl, mix together all the sauce ingredients until well combined.
  • Cook the aromatics : Heat a generous amount of vegetable oil in a pan over medium heat. Add the garlic, spring onion, and chilli, and stir-fry gently until fragrant. Do not let the garlic brown.
  • Add the sauce : Pour in the sauce mixture and let it simmer for 1–2 minutes.
  • Toss the noodles : Add the softened noodles to the pan and toss gently until they absorb the sauce and are evenly coated.
  • Finish & serve : Turn off the heat, sprinkle with coriander, and serve immediately.
